首页 综合百科文章正文

数据库系统的软件

综合百科 2025年11月22日 04:11 253 admin

构建数据管理的核心引擎

在当今信息化社会,数据已成为企业与个人不可或缺的宝贵资源,随着数据量的激增,如何高效、安全地存储、管理和分析这些信息成为了一个亟待解决的问题,数据库系统软件,作为这一挑战的解答者,扮演着至关重要的角色,本文将深入探讨数据库系统软件的定义、核心功能、关键技术以及其在各行各业中的广泛应用,揭示其如何成为支撑现代数据生态的基石。

数据库系统的软件

数据库系统软件的定义与重要性

数据库系统软件是指用于创建、维护和操作数据库的软件工具集,它允许用户以结构化的方式存储数据,并提供高效的查询、更新和管理手段,在大数据时代背景下,数据库系统软件的重要性体现在以下几个方面:一是确保数据的一致性和完整性;二是提供强大的数据安全性保护机制;三是支持复杂的数据分析和处理需求;四是促进跨平台的数据共享与协作。

数据库系统的软件

核心功能解析

  1. 数据定义与建模:通过SQL等语言定义数据库结构,包括表、视图、索引等,实现数据的有效组织。
  2. 数据操纵与查询:支持数据的插入、删除、修改和查询操作,利用SQL语句快速获取所需信息。
  3. 事务管理:确保一组相关操作要么全部执行,要么完全不执行,保证数据的一致性和可靠性。
  4. 并发控制:管理多个用户或进程同时访问数据库的情况,防止冲突和数据损坏。
  5. 恢复机制:在系统故障后能够恢复到最近一致的状态,保障业务连续性。

关键技术探索

  • 关系型数据库管理系统(RDBMS):基于关系模型,使用表格来表示数据及其关系,如MySQL、Oracle、SQL Server等。
  • 非关系型数据库(NoSQL):适用于大规模分布式环境,包括文档型(如MongoDB)、键值型(如Redis)、列存储型(如HBase)等。
  • 云数据库服务:随着云计算的发展,越来越多的数据库服务迁移到云端,提供弹性伸缩、高可用性等特点,如Amazon RDS、Google Cloud SQL。
  • 数据仓库与数据湖:专为大数据分析和报告设计,前者侧重于结构化数据,后者则能容纳结构化和非结构化数据。

行业应用实例

  • 金融领域:银行利用数据库软件进行风险管理、交易记录和客户信息管理。
  • 电子商务:电商平台依赖数据库处理海量商品信息、订单数据及用户行为分析。
  • 医疗健康:医院信息系统(HIS)中,数据库软件用于病历管理、药物库存控制和患者预约安排。
  • 社交媒体:社交平台依靠数据库存储用户资料、帖子内容及互动历史,实现个性化推荐和广告定向投放。

数据库系统软件是现代信息技术体系的心脏,它不仅关乎数据的物理存储,更涉及到数据的智能管理和价值挖掘。

标签: 数据库系统

丫丫技术百科 备案号:新ICP备2024010732号-62 网站地图